This instrument includes a hand carved "cello style" tailpiece, a common featurs of Le Voi's guitars.
The top has a genuine heat bent pliage, done in the manner of the original Selmer. This feature is normally only found on very expensive flagship guitars by Dupont and Barault.
This guitar was originally owned by Laurence Juber (lead guitarist for Paul McCartney's wings and award winning solo fingerstylist).
The condition is excellent, with only some light pick and fret wear. There was once a strap peg on the back which was moved to the heel. The hole is still visible on the back.
Includes original case with Laurence Juber's name painted on the side. The case is in poor condition and should probably be replaced, although it does have some nostalgic value.
